Computer Based TrainingKofax's Computer Based Training and Certification for ACI Server 7 uses our standard classroom training materials coupled with instructor presentations, demonstrations (presented on compact discs) and hands-on labs to give technical professionals the training they need to design, implement and support component-based document imaging and forms processing solutions.

This course is targeted toward Kofax Solutions Providers and end users who have had training or equivalent experience with Ascent Capture, as well as Microsoft's Internet Information Server (IIS).  The class covers Ascent Capture Internet Server (ACIS), a web server-based solution designed to maximize efficiency and cost-effectiveness when the document source is located away from the centralized capture network.

This hands-on course is designed to provide practice and a deeper understanding of ACIS as a viable solution for remote capture in a batch-oriented, production-level environment.  Trainees will install and use both server and client-side applications.

Prerequisites

To maximize their learning experience, students should meet the following prerequisites:

  • Certification or in-depth understanding of Ascent Capture 7
  • Training or equivalent experience using Microsoft IIS version 5 or version 6
  • Understanding of TCP/IP
  • Working knowledge of Client/Server networks including IIS and NTFS securities

Goals

By the end of this class, trainees will be able to:

  • Install and configure the Ascent Capture service, Ascent Capture Internet Server and the Remote Synchronization agent
  • Use an ACIS installation to centrally manage remotely created batches
  • Make recommendations about bandwidth requirements based on document volume
  • Discuss the most appropriate solution for a given remote capture or validation scenario
  • Provide clear instructions for those responsible for day-to-day operation of the installation
  • Pass a certification  examination with a score of 80% or better
